3 new judges added to Kane County judiciary
ST. CHARLES – Kane County’s judiciary has added three new judges to its ranks, including the county’s first Hispanic judge, its first openly gay judge, and a former chief prosecutor.
On Thursday, the three judges – former Kane County State’s Attorney John Barsanti, Aurora lawyer Rene Cruz and Elgin lawyer John Dalton – took the oath of office in a ceremony before a capacity crowd in the Kane County Branch Court in St. Charles.
Cruz, who becomes the county’s first Hispanic judge, praised his parents for the example they set in decades of service to their family and country, including his father’s military service in Vietnam.
